GLOBAL OPERATIONAL RISK

The Global Risk Management team is uniquely positioned within the firm as part of Goldman Sachs Asset Management. The team is responsible for independent oversight and risk governance covering all elements of operational risks including risks related to personal data. The team regularly interacts with a wide range of teams across Goldman Sachs Asset Management including embedded risk managers, and various Federation groups that cover Goldman Sachs Asset Management, including the Legal, Compliance, the Risk Division and Controllers in order to effectively monitor risk and continually improve upon our risk governance framework. The team is also responsible for risk monitoring and regulatory reporting for the global fund complex.
